'>>61480674
>Check for a physical address listed on the site, and visit it on google street view to confirm it's actually an existing gun shop.
This is good advice in general, it's amazing how much scam shit one can weed out with google street view. It's a tool everyone has heard of yet in my experience almost zero people think to ever use for checking out an online merchant.

For guns specifically it's also worth noting that FFL info is not private, it's a federal government thing and you can look them up. You can download all FFLs in the US, or by state/territory or whatever:
>https://www.atf.gov/firearms/listing-federal-firearms-licensees
ATF literally runs something called "FFLeZCheck":
>https://fflezcheck.atf.gov/FFLEzCheck/
Nobody legit should ever be shy about giving you their license number. If they rip you off you'll have a person and address. And if THAT info is fake it means they lied to get an FFL to the federal government and you will get way, way, WAY more attention out of it then nearly any other scam online.'

'>>61487147
>It's either their website has extremely poor security/encryption or there's someone employed over there who steals credit card info and it's been happening for more than a year now.
This is just a general pro-tip for everyone about online purchases in general: it depends on bank, but a number of credit card companies offer some sort of "virtual credit card number" service. You go to the site or app or something, and then you can enter an amount and expiration date and it'll generate a credit card number+cc that acts identical to a normal one, you can use it like normal at a site. But you can set the balance amount to be just above what your purchase will be and then even if someone gets the number and data they can't use it for anything else.

I don't use them for everything but find they're pretty good when I'm really trying to go for deals from some place that has more question marks particularly if it's the first time I'm doing business with them. Can use a VCC and have way more assurance they can't do shit.'
